220 CC

Hit the Water Running

What makes the 220 CC a great center console? Maybe it’s the sharp forward entry, large bow flare and variable deadrise hull that makes it ride better than a lot of bigger boats. Or it could be the high sides and deep interior freeboard that make it feel so secure and safe even in outsized seas. Then there’s the fact that it has an insulated fishbox that drains overboard and under-gunnel rod storage, features that other boats its size can’t claim. And what about the hidden rear seat with flip-up backrest and battery storage underneath? Put it all together and the 220 CC is the most feature-rich and big water-ready 22-footer out there.

Specifications

Length
21 ft 07 in
Beam
8 ft 09 in
Draft
18 in
Weight (approx. with engine)
3,460 lbs
Fuel Capacity
89 gal
Deadrise
18 deg
Max HP
250 hp
Transom Height
25 in
Maximum Capacities
9 persons or 1,600 lbs

Running Surface

A Drier, More Comfortable Ride

Cobia’s ride is engineered to keep you dry and comfortable in real conditions. A sharp, narrow bow entry slices cleanly through waves to reduce impact, while generous bow flare pushes water up and away from the boat - keeping spray out of the cockpit. Combined with a forward hull design that maintains depth and freeboard, the result is a softer, drier ride with added confidence when the water turns rough.
